Students and Industry Connect for Smart Manufacturing and Energy Management
The East Tennessee Initiative for Smart Energy Management (ETISE) brings current Engineering Vols together with participating regional companies for collaboration on energy- and cost-efficient practices in manufacturing.
Transportation Planning Goes Viral
Professor Xueping Li and his interdisciplinary, multi-institutional team have been awarded funding from the US Department of Energy to launch a first-of-its-kind, national-scale undertaking to address freight’s impact on climate change.
